The quarterfinals of the Italian Cup are behind us and today (Saturday) the 25th round of Serie A started with three meetings. In the spotlight, Napoli hosted Inter in a meeting that mainly served Milan and ended in a 1-1 draw. Lazio defeated Bologna 0: 3 and Dor Peretz rose with Venice over the red line with a 1: 2 victory over Torino.

Lazio – Bologna 0: 3

Maurizio Sari and his players were humiliated in the quarter-finals of the Cup when they snatched 4-0 from Milan and also in the league they have won only two of the last five rounds. But tonight the Blues from Rome returned to impress in the league and narrowed the gap from fourth Juventus to just three points. Chiro Immobilia, the king of league goals, scored with a penalty in the 13th minute. Luis Alberto cooked for Matthias Zacani (53), who completed a double 10 minutes later. Lazio dreams of a place in the Champions League, Bologna is nearing the bottom.

Napoli – Inter 1: 1

The Narazzi led last Saturday in the big derby against AC Milan and were very close to widening the gap between them to seven points, but Olivier Giroud with a dramatic double in the 75th and 78th minute made it 1: 2 to Rossoneri, the gap between the two dropped to just one point and Napoli took advantage to narrow it. Inter recovered from the loss with a win over Roma and Jose Mourinho en route to the semi-finals, but tonight the two greats met and ended in a draw that mainly serves the Rossoneri, who are now just two points away from the summit. Lorenzo Insigne put the hosts ahead in the seventh minute. Inter looked for the equalizer and found it two minutes after the break from a goal by Edin Dzeko, who took advantage of Coulibaly’s dreaminess and kicked close to the high corner. Inter are still leading but only one point ahead of Napoli and two points ahead of AC Milan. In four days, Inter are expecting a huge meeting against Liverpool in the first game of the Champions League quarter-finals.

Turin – Venice 2: 1

A precious victory from Venice, which rises above the red line. Josip Berkla added another Torino to an early lead in the fifth minute, but Domen Chernigoy cooked for Rigdicino to zero the equalizer (38), and 30 seconds after the start of the second half scored the winning goal. The home side almost scratched a point, but Andrea Balotti’s equalizer in extra time was disqualified after a long VAR check, and while the second goal remained was not achieved even though David Okrka of Venice was sent off (90 + 9). Dor Peretz, who entered in the 78th minute, helped Venice to maintain the result with difficulty.
